#ef6606 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#ef6606 is composed of 93.7% red, 40% green and 2.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 57.3% magenta, 97.5% yellow and 6.3% black. It has a hue angle of 24.7 degrees, a saturation of 95.1% and a lightness of 48%. #ef6606 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ffcc0c with #df0000. Closest websafe color is: #ff6600.

● #ef6606 color description : Vivid orange.
#ef6606 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#ef6606 has RGB values of R:239, G:102, B:6 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.57, Y:0.97, K:0.06. Its decimal value is 15689222.

Shades and Tints of #ef6606
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#090400 is the darkest color, while #fff9f5 is the lightest one.

Tones of #ef6606
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#7e7a77 is the less saturated color, while #ef6606 is the most saturated one.
